This is a shout out for mom!
She has only been asking me for about a year about the day of a missionary so here goes.
6:15 the alarm goes off and we pray
6:30 exercise! Sometimes we go run in the park, do yoga, other stuff in the house.
7:00 shower and make and eat breakfast
8:00 personal study (scriptures, Preach my gospel, etc. )
9:00 companionship study , share what we studied and plan our lessons.
10:00 language study, normally just out of the grammar book they gave us or read the church magazines in Spanish and look up the words I dont know.
11:00 LA CHAMBA. going to visit members, less active members, recent converts, investigators, and teaching them the gospel! (based on Preach My Gospel) contacting referrals people have given us, talking to people in the street, sometimes Family nights with the members.
2:00 pm, go to a members house for lunch. They pass around a calendar in relief society and the hermanas sign up to give us food!
3:00 LA CHAMBA 
until
9:00 return home!
Then we plan for the next day, wrtie down which lessons we taught, eat a little bit. Get ready for bed.
10:30 to the hammock!
And that is it!
It changes a little bit with different meetings or activities that we have, but really every day is a surprise! Every day there are ups and downs, rarely does a day go as planned haha. It is a good work. This week I hit my 13 month mark. So fast it has gone by!
